5 killed in Anambra cult war

About five persons were reportedly killed in a cult clash at Ogidi and Ogbunike axis of Idemili-North and Oyi local government areas of Anambra state.

Source told Blueprint that the cult war was between Supreme Vikings Confraternity (Bagas) and other yet to be identified rival cult groups over unknown issues.

Meanwhile, the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O) Anambra state Command, Haruna Muhammed, while reacting to the incident disclosed that three persons were killed in a cult clash.

Muhammed, who declined comments on identity of cult groups involved or reasons behind the war, added that the command’s rapid response team quelled the battle that would have claimed more lives.

“It was a cult clash. They equally shot two others at Ogidi. Police patrol teams rushed to the scene and took the victims to Iyenu hospital for medical attention but were certified dead on arrival. Meanwhile, the Police are intensifying efforts to apprehend perpetrators in order to bring them to justice,” he stated.
